Is there an easy way to check for leaks without roasting the crap out of your hand!

If you can't tell then you are probably fine especially if its running ok - you'd hear it as well especially with it being right next to the head. Realistically the exhaust is to get the exhaust gases out of the way and prevent any gasses / crap from going back in to the cylinder Smile

Only way to check without burning your hands would be to use something like kitchen roll and see if it flutters about next to the pipe (indicating a leak). If it doesn't move, you should be fine - might be able to use paper but it will probably be too stiff to move with a slight leak
